<p>The invention comprises 17b -acyloxy-des-A-estr-9-ene-5-one derivatives of the general formula: <FORM:0930975/IV(a)/1> where R indicates =O or (a -H)OH and Ac represents an acyl radical derived from an organic carboxylic acid, preferably a benzoyl radical. The 5-cyclic-ketals of 17b -acyloxy-des-A-estr-9(II)-en-5-ones and of 17b -acyloxy - 9a ,11a -epoxy-des-A-estran-5-ones are also novel compounds. The 17b -acyloxy-des-A-estr-9-en-5-one derivatives are made reacting a 17b -acyloxy-des-A-estr-9-en-5-one with a ketalizing agent, e.g. ethylene glycol in the presence of p-toluene sulphonic acid, to form the 5-cyclic ketal which is reacted with an epoxidizing agent, e.g., perphthalic acid, to yield the corresponding epoxy compound, and the latter is treated with an acid reagent, e.g. a mixture of acetic acid, ethyl acetate and water, to open the epoxide bridge and hydrolyse the ketal yielding the 11-hydroxy-17b -acyloxy-des-A-estr-9-en-5-one of the above general formula where R is (a -H)OH. This product may be treated with an oxidising agent, such as manganese dioxide, to yield the 17b -acyloxy-des-A-estr-9-ene-5,11-dione having the above general formula where R is =O. Detailed examples are given in which the benzyloxy derivatives are formed and the ketal is the ethylene ketal. Other acyloxy substituents mentioned are acetoxy, trimethylacetoxy, propionyloxy, b - cyclopentylpropionyloxy phenylpropionyloxy, 4,4 - dimethylpentanoyloxy, 10-undecanonyloxy and hexahydrobenzoyloxy. The propylene ketal is also mentioned.</p> |
